Security operatives under Operation Enduring Peace (OPEP) have restored order following a public disturbance and mob action at Zololo Junction in Jos North Local Government Area of Plateau State.
A security source said troops responded at about 1:00 p.m. on June 15 after receiving reports that suspected criminals operating in a commercial tricycle (Keke NAPEP) had robbed a female passenger of her mobile phone and pushed her out of the moving vehicle.
The source disclosed that the incident triggered outrage among bystanders, who intercepted the tricycle and apprehended two suspects.
According to the source, the angry mob set the tricycle ablaze in retaliation.
Security operatives of Keystone intervened promptly and rescued the suspects from being lynched, subsequently handing them over to the police for further investigation and necessary action.
The source added that normalcy was restored to the area, with free flow of traffic re-established shortly after the intervention.
Authorities cautioned residents against taking laws into their own hands and urged the public to report criminal activities to security agencies for proper action.
